I saw a similar question posted here a few or so days ago. I can't find the link to it. But they had mentioned a thought bubble over the Sims head that had a clock in it.
This might mean that there's something on the wall preventing them from cooking. I'm not entirely sure.
Here are some tips to try:
1. Put up the walls to see if there's any cabinets, vents or decor that maybe too large and/or blocking the Sims cooking. - It's been reported removing the obstructing item helps.
2. Delete the fridge and/or stove and replace them with less expensive or better appliances.
3. Outdated Mods/CC are known to cause this issue. Best way to test if mods are the problem is: Move your mods folder to the desktop, clear the game cache and delete the localthumbcache.package from the Sims 4 folder to help with troubleshooting.

4. Repair Game:
In Origin > Games Library, right-click on Sims 4 and select Repair.
